Many skills and technologies used in oil and gas extraction are transferable to geothermal energy production. Traditional drilling technologies can only perform so well, and the process is limited by how deeply one can drill. One of the key challenges in geothermal energy production has been accessing the Earth’s heat at viable depths. Successful geothermal operations in the U.S., Canada, Iceland, and Italy are providing clear evidence of the energy source’s feasibility and economic viability. Modern geothermal technology has significantly evolved over the last few years, enabling both the generation of electricity and for providing heating and cooling solutions in residential, commercial, and industrial applications. Geothermal is a virtually inexhaustible power source, available 24/7, while creating a minimal environmental impact. Geothermal energy is derived from the Earth’s internal heat, which is continuously generated by the decay of radioactive isotopes in the planet’s core and from relict heat. Maureen “Mo” Kane Dean married White House Counsel John Dean in 1972. Eventually, Dean was fired by Nixon, cooperated with prosecutors, and plead guilty to obstruction of justice. When he was finally tasked with completing an entire report on the Watergate scandal, at the direction of President Nixon, he started pulling back. At first, Dean was directly involved with the Watergate cover-up - taking charge of destroying files and more. John Dean served as the White House Counsel between 1970-1973, deep in the middle of the Watergate scandal. The most important quality to know about Mitchell? He put his loyalty to President Nixon ahead of his wife, who endured gaslighting from Nixon’s cronies. In 1975, Mitchell was found guilty of conspiracy, obstruction of justice, and perjury. Mitchell was directly involved with the Watergate scandal, and instructed former FBI agent, Steve King, to make sure his wife didn’t leave her California hotel room and begin sharing information about the scandal with reporters. Martha Mitchell passed away in 1976, roughly four years following the Watergate scandal. “If it hadn’t been for Martha, there’d have been no Watergate,” Nixon memorably said, per Slate’s Slowburn podcast. But after President Nixon’s 1977 interview with David Frost, she was wholly vindicated. Reactions to Mitchell - even her effort to try and defend her husband’s direct involvement in the scandal - varied. Nixon’s allies set out on a mission make Martha look like a hysterical drunk to lead the nation astray from what she knew of the Watergate scandal. But when it became clear Martha might start talking to reporters, she was kidnapped, drugged, and subdued by Nixon’s lackeys. At the height of the Watergate scandal, Martha Mitchell was privy to quite a bit of information that was being relayed to her husband - a noted Nixon loyalist.
